Is Southern Oregon liberal?

Linn County, between the liberal cities of Eugene and Salem, has voted for the Republican presidential candidate in every election since 1980. Southern Oregon is also a Republican stronghold, except in Jackson County, which frequently votes for both Republican and Democratic candidates.

What state has the lowest crime rate?

Maine
Maine gets the best score of all states for violent crime per capita, which is the most important factor in our rankings and counts twice as much as each of the other three. There were only 1,466 violent crimes reported in Maine in 2020, or 108.6 for every 100,000 people.

How far is Medford Oregon from the ocean?

118 miles
Medford is 27 miles north of the California border, 118 miles east of the Pacific Ocean, and 75 miles west of Klamath Falls. Medford’s location gives it ready access to numerous feeder highways.

Does Medford have snow?

The snowy period of the year lasts for 1.6 months, from December 5 to January 25, with a sliding 31-day snowfall of at least 1.0 inches. The month with the most snow in Medford is December, with an average snowfall of 1.3 inches.
